Q: Is 10,212,303 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 10,212,303 is not a prime number.

Why is 10,212,303 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 10212303 can be evenly divided by 1 3 1,163 2,927 3,489 8,781 3,404,101 and 10,212,303, with no remainder.

Since 10,212,303 cannot be divided by just 1 and 10,212,303, it is not a prime number.
